我在Mac OS X 10.6.4上使用clisp 2.48(2009-07-28)。我用“sudo port install clisp”下载了clisp。
安装quick lisp之后,我安装了一些软件包,大多数都可以。
但是,当我尝试安装“sqlite”时,出现以下错误。
[1]>(ql:quickload“sqlite”)
加载“sqlite”:
加载1个ASDF系统:
sqlite
;加载“sqlite”
[软件包cffi-sys]
***-CFFI需要使用动态FFI支持编译的CLISP。
它说我的Mac端口安装的clisp不支持FFI。
在Mac OS X上,有什么方法可以通过动态FFI支持来编译CLISP?
最佳答案
我使用的是10.4,所以我还必须安装ffcall-我不知道您是否已经安装了它。安装clisp时,我在末尾添加了+ dynffi,它对我有用。sudo port install ffcall
sudo port install clisp +dynffi
关于common-lisp - 有没有办法在Mac OS上使用动态FFI支持来编译CLISP?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/3901698/